Sonam's letter

"My name is Sonam Dhondup, aged 25 yrs. old, escaped from Tibet in the year 2003; except  me, the rest of my family members are in Tibet. I can only talk to them occasionally but I don't know when I can see them again. Ever since coming into exile, I have always wanted to go on a year long pilgrimage to major Buddhist sacred sites in India and Nepal, doing prostration at those sacred places for the sake of world peace and prosperity. I wish to accumulate approximately 36000 prostrations in a year.

   I have had done prostration along with my sister and parents when I was 11 years old, from my hometown of Tawu, eastern Tibet to Lhasa visiting all the pilgrimage sites on the way, which took 3 years and 7 months. Then again, I repeated the same procedure when I was 16 yrs. old.

   Now that after being 7 years in India, I have learned enough passable Hindi. So, I think it's the right time for me to fulfill the wishes of my parents to go on a pilgrimage by doing prostration in the land of Buddha.

   In order to accomplish this great journey, I am ready to leave my decent job but still the major obstacle is that I just need some money to sustain me during this period of more than 1 year. Therefore, I humbly beg and entreat you with folded palms to sponsor for this genuine cause."
